Samsung Brain Health: Detecting Early Dementia Signs
Here’s a summary of the Android Authority article:
Samsung is planning to launch a “Brain Health” service at CES 2026.
* What it does: The service will analyze data from your Samsung smartphone and wearable devices (like smartwatches) to detect changes in cognitive function, perhaps offering early detection of conditions like dementia.
* Data collected: It will analyze voice patterns, gait (how you walk), and sleep patterns. Previous announcements mentioned analyzing message patterns, typing speed, and app usage, but this wasn’t confirmed for the launch.
* Potential benefits: Beyond detection,the service could also offer personalized brain training programs to help improve cognitive abilities.
* Background: Samsung initially announced this technology in September, demonstrating the ability to track cognitive changes through phone and wearable data. This CES proclamation appears to be the commercial rollout of that technology.
